Output 4c1568623912b5f65874821fd6ae1a5bf9dd1d69cd193b33899cb839b2e40be2:2

value
25883697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c7908bb2db3f245856fe1a0dd88cbbc303ef08 OP_EQUAL
address
3E4xDSA6Fka9wbG4FGPyi7uBCecear7ixJ
transaction
4c1568623912b5f65874821fd6ae1a5bf9dd1d69cd193b33899cb839b2e40be2
spent
true